I just looked at the data sheet.  It says:
   Frequency Pulling: ±20ppm APR Min.

I was going to ask what APR meant.  In case anybody else is also curious...

The CVS575-500 data sheet says "Absolute Pull Range".

Google found these (and more):
  http://www.vectron.com/products/appnotes/abspullrange.pdf
  http://www.crystek.com/microwave/appnotes/AbsolutePullingRangeAPR.pdf

The Vectron version doesn't mention the initial calibration.  The Crystek version does.

It looks like they are trying to tell me that it's the number a designer needs:  I can tune anywhere within that band for any temp/voltage/aging/initial-calibration.

They don't specify a lifetime so you might have to round down a bit if you expect your box to last a long time.
